How they compare
Togo currently reports 157,296 US dollar per square kilometre against 135,362 US dollar per square kilometre in Haiti, a difference of 21,934 US dollar per square kilometre.
That makes Togo's figure about 1.2 times Haiti's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 22 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Haiti ahead.
Haiti ranks 116th and Togo ranks 113th of 169 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Haiti averaged higher in 3 and Togo in 1.

About this data
Total assets, Adjusted using IMF accounting records (Assets, Positions, US dollar)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
